Review- HGUC Byarlant Custom

15/01/2013 by bd77

Now it’s time for one of the huge MS units in the Unicorn series, the RX-160S Byarlant Custom.

The monster MS in the Unicorn episode 4.

This, by far, one of the more unique non-Zeon MS design.

The in the Unicorn OVA, the Byarlant Custom was an experimental unit designed with additional fuel tanks and thrusters for prolong aerial use.

As we can see from the rear, in addition to the large engine pods the side of the shoulders, it also houses an enlarged backpack thrusters with attached external fuel/engine pods. The lower waist thruster is also enlarged.

The Byarlant Custom features a compound eye system, a rarity for a non-Zeon MS. Here the clear green part covers the eyes in the head and extends to the top main camera. Sadly the movement of the head is restricted by the design of the sides of the head.

The arms are not joined to the torso directly, rather, its’ connected via a three-point joint system. The large side engine pods are attached by these.

Like most recent HGUC kits, Bandai incorporates MG-like frames with large units. Sadly, the inner wall of the thruster shielding had to be done with red seals/stickers, you’ll note the misalignment.

The foot of this kit is unlike many had done before, the two “claws” are independently movable. So does the front tip.

Extra armour-plating for the ankles, the light blue piece at the side is movable.

The Byarlant Custom’s shoulder, as a whole, is a dedicated engine, hence the arms are not joined directly to the torso. Yes, the red part for the inner wall of the thruster’s shielding vents are also seals/stickers.

The arms are… not exactly your typical arm. First off, it has TWO forearms. One houses the rapid-firing short-burst beam cannon, the other is for the claw arm.
